Hey — quick handover before I'm out. The snapshot tests for the Fernwick component library are mostly green, but the modal and tooltip snapshots are flaky on CI because of font loading timing. I've quarantined those two; don't block the release on them. Everything else should be safe to ship. If anything weird shows up in the diff report, there's one person who knows this suite inside out, and that's who you should ping.

account owner for fajep-yagef: Kasix Eliiel

## Tuning rate limits

The Cobblewick gateway rate-limits every internal API by team token, not by host. New team members: do not raise limits per-route; adjust the shared bucket instead, or bursty callers will starve batch jobs. Limits are enforced with a sliding window backed by the Mirefell counter store, so changes propagate within about a minute. Staging uses the same constants as prod by design—test there first. The window sizes, burst allowances, and refill rates are defined below.

limits module of fajog-tawig:
RATE_LIMITS = {
    "druwyn": 2,
    "quenael": 10,
    "wenix": 2,
    "druael": 2,
}

Subject: DR drill — Cartovane prefetcher review

Hi — as part of Thursday's disaster-recovery drill, we're failing over the map-tile prefetcher to the Brindlemoor standby cluster. Please review the queue-drain patch before then; the prefetcher must pause cleanly or we'll re-fetch the entire tile cache on restore. Pay attention to the checkpoint interval and the retry backoff in the worker loop. During the drill you'll need to unseal the standby's config vault manually. Use the recovery passphrase noted below when the console asks.

vault phrase of kafog-kahif = holdor-rusir-praox

**Q: What happens when Mailcull marks a bounce as permanent?**

Mailcull, our email bounce processor, classifies hard bounces after three consecutive failures and suppresses the address automatically. Soft bounces are retried for 72 hours. If the suppression list itself becomes corrupted, restore it from the encrypted nightly snapshot in the Thornfield backup bucket. Restoring requires the team recovery passphrase, which is kept directly below this entry for emergencies.

unlock words, kahof-bahap: praax-ulaix